Red face I assumed everybody Knew about this one.

On Monday, Oprah had a couple of (formerly married, but still very loving and Respectful) couples on, where the wife had not realized that she was gay until after several years of marriage, and some kids. She told her husband who was very loving, but confused, and they tried to work it out, and finally parted. They're still friends, the wives have found new partners, one of the men discovered that HE was gay, and on family get togethers they ALL get together, TWO girlfriends, TWO boyfriends, all of the kids, and various therapists! (I'm late for an appointment) Goto Oprah.com, they must have some kind of archive.

The overriding message throughout the show was that, no matter what situation the couples found themselves in, they continued to treat each other with Love and Respect.
